MOTHER SHAKUNTLA KIDS CARE ZONE: A Detailed Look at a Rural Bihar School

Nestled in the rural heartland of Bihar, MOTHER SHAKUNTLA KIDS CARE ZONE stands as a testament to the ongoing efforts to provide education in underserved communities. Established in 2011, this co-educational institution offers primary and upper primary education, catering to students from Class 1 to Class 8. Its management is currently unrecognized, highlighting the challenges faced by many such schools in ensuring consistent support and resources.

The school's infrastructure, though functional, presents a mixed picture. While it boasts 11 classrooms, all in good condition, the building itself is privately owned and described as "Pucca But Broken," indicating a need for potential repairs and maintenance. The lack of electricity underscores a crucial infrastructural gap, impacting teaching and learning, especially in the evenings. The absence of a library, playground, and computer-aided learning facilities further limits the scope of educational opportunities offered.

Despite these challenges, the school demonstrates a commitment to providing education. A total of 13 teachers, comprising 10 male and 3 female educators, dedicate their efforts to shaping young minds. The primary language of instruction is Hindi, reflecting the local linguistic landscape. The school's accessibility is ensured by its all-weather road approach, facilitating student attendance regardless of weather conditions.

The school's sanitation facilities, while present, necessitate attention. Seven functional boys' toilets and three functional girls' toilets exist, however, the numbers may need to be increased to meet the growing needs of the student population. The reliable availability of drinking water through hand pumps is a positive aspect, ensuring students have access to safe hydration throughout the school day.

The academic year commences in April, aligning with the broader educational calendar in the region.
